At What Age Should Children Always Be Placed In The Back Seat?

To maximize safety, keep your child in the car seat for as long as possible, as long as the child fits within the manufacturer’s height and weight requirements. Keep your child in the back seat at least through age 12 . Your child under age 1 should always ride in a rear-facing car seat.

Do you have to ride in the backseat with a baby?

The American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P) recommends that infants and toddlers ride in a rear-facing seat until they reach the highest weight and height limits recommended by the seat’s manufacturer . Safety experts say to do this based on a child’s size, not age. Small children can stay rear-facing until age 3 or 4.

Can you hold a baby while driving?

Never hold a baby or child on your lap when riding in a car . If you are wearing your seat belt, the violent forces created during a crash will tear the child from your arms. ... Never put your seat belt over yourself and a child. During a crash, the belt could press deep into the child and cause serious internal injuries.

Is height or weight more important for car seats?

In other words, the fit is best determined by height and weight of the child , and is not specific to age,” Dau explains. ... Most car seat manufacturers recommend children remain in a rear-facing seat until they reach 30-40 pounds. Forward-facing car seats range in weight limits between 40 and 80 pounds.

What is the age and weight limit for car seats?

California Law. Current California Law: Children under 2 years of age shall ride in a rear-facing car seat unless the child weighs 40 or more pounds OR is 40 or more inches tall . The child shall be secured in a manner that complies with the height and weight limits specified by the manufacturer of the car seat.

What is the height and weight limit for an infant car seat?

Most have a weight limit of 30-35 pounds and a height limitation of 32 inches tall . If your child fits comfortably in their infant seat, is still within the seat’s weight and height limit, and you want to keep them in this seat — go for it!

How much does a child have to weigh to face forward?

While 1 year and 20 pounds used to be the standard for when to flip car seats around, most experts now recommend using rear-facing child seats until children are 2 years old and reach the top weight and height recommendations of the car seat manufacturer, which is typically around 30 pounds and 36 inches.

Can newborns go on long car rides?

Many car seat manufacturers recommend that a baby should not be in a car seat for longer than 2 hours , within a 24 hour time period. This is because when a baby is in a semi-upright position for a prolonged period of time it can result in: ... A strain on the baby’s still-developing spine.
